Készítsd el a saját android-firmware, 1. rész
Fejlesztése Android firmware - működési környezet beállítás
Gyakran előfordul, hogy a mobil eszközök jön egy nem optimalizált firmware a gyártó, ami után egy rövid használat munkába lassú és bizonytalan. Sokan szembesülnek ilyen magatartást firmware emberek keresnek egy szabványos megoldás a hálózat, egy részük fel saját firmware saját eszközök.
Ez az első a három részből álló sorozat, amelyben megpróbálom leírni a leginkább érthető nyelven a folyamat firmware Android-önszerveződés az eszközön.
Ha szeretne építeni Android firmware-t, akkor meg kell telepíteni a Linux-disztribúció számítógép, de ha nem tud szánni egy számítógép erre a célra, akkor könnyen kezelheti a virtuális gép a Linux-rendszert.
Fogom használni a barátságos Ubuntu 16.04 rendszer, ajánlom neked.
követelmények
- Linux disztribúció
- Legalább 200 GB szabad hely a merevlemezen vagy szilárdtest meghajtó
- Egy erős számítógép, legalább 4 GB RAM-mal és produktív quad CPU
- A minőségi Internet kapcsolat sebessége legalább 600 kb / s
Ha van, amire szüksége van, akkor kezd működni.
Az összes parancs ebben a cikkben kell végezni az alkalmazás terminál és természetesen nem fogom megismételni minden parancs után.
Ha a rendszer nincs telepítve a Java virtuális gép, akkor futtassa a következő parancsot, hogy telepítse együtt minden könyvtár:
szerelő szerszámok
Futtassa a következő parancsot, hogy telepítse a szerszám (a végrehajtás időbe telhet függően az internetkapcsolat sebességétől):
Ne hiszem, mi ez? Nos, ez egy fontos eszköz szükséges kapcsolódni a szerverhez, és töltse le a forráskódot, amelyet később szükség. Az elnevezés a „repository” kijelölő központi tárolója egyes források. Ebben az esetben a tároló tárolja a forráskódját a szoftver komponensek kell összeállítani, és hozzáadjuk a generált firmware.
Futtassa a következő parancsot, hogy telepítse az eszközt, amiről a rendszer:
Ez egy hasznos segédprogram, amely használt cache bináris fájlokat, és lehetővé teszi, hogy csökkentsék fordításkor (körülbelül 50%).
Inicializálni, az alábbi parancsot:
Természetesen ahelyett, hogy a fenti értékek, meg kell adnia a számos ingyenes gigabájt a merevlemezen.
Megtekintéséhez a statisztikák a cache, használja az alábbi parancsot:
Ha törölni a cache fájlokat - az alábbi parancsot:
Beállítása a munkakörnyezet majdnem kész - nyitva hagyott bash.rc file:
Most meg kell, hogy az utolsó sorban a fájlt, és helyezze be a következő sorokat:
Itt az ideje, hogy indítsa újra a rendszert.
Ez a következő két sor cikkeket a firmware építési folyamat!